Sultana is still undefeated this season after their contest against Granite Hills on Thursday, but Granite Hills came as close as anyone has to beating them. The Sultans narrowly escaped with a win as the squad sidled past the Cougars 4-2. The four-run effort marked the Sultans' lowest-scoring game of the season, but in the end it didn't matter.
LJ Borrego was a major factor while hitting and pitching. On the mound, he tossed five innings while giving up just one earned run off two hits. He has been consistent recently: he hasn't tossed less than five strikeouts in four consecutive appearances. He was also solid in the batter's box, getting on base in three of his four plate appearances with two stolen bases and one run. That's the most stolen bases he has posted since back in April of 2025.
Borrego wasn't the only one making solid contact as three players wound up with at least one hit. One of them was Isac Gamez, who went 2-for-4 with one RBI.
Sultana's record now sits at 7-0. As for Granite Hills, they now have a losing record of 3-4.
Coming up, Sultana will challenge Rialto at 3:15 p.m. on Friday. As for Granite Hills, they will be taking part in a tournament against Polytechnic at 1:00 p.m. on Saturday. The last three games the Panthers have played have been within two runs, so don't be surprised if it's a close one.
